Output ef8befc19b2ea5d73614262770643680ac4feb1b056d097a5bd4b7f28c14cfaf:0

value
660328359
script pubkey
OP_0 OP_PUSHBYTES_20 e04bfcfadc06825e9c9670fde11060048e1ceb54
address
ltc1qup9le7kuq6p9a8ykwr77zyrqqj8pe665yue2sz
transaction
ef8befc19b2ea5d73614262770643680ac4feb1b056d097a5bd4b7f28c14cfaf
spent
true